Many popular cosmetics contain fragrances. This is a major problem for people who are allergic to perfumes. It is no fun to have your eyes tearing up and the skin puffing up around your eyes, and this is a common reaction by those with fragrance sensitivities. Mineral cosmetics are safe cosmetics to use on the face and especially around the eyes because they do not contain any fragrances.

My mother always told me that just because something is natural doesn't mean that it is good for you. Deadly nightshade, for example, is natural. Hemlock is natural. Many, many different natural things will kill you. Nevertheless, I have still always been prone to buying things with the word "natural" on the packaging. Whether it is natural food, natural cosmetics, our natural hair products, I am a sucker for it all. I guess it is because I am well-meaning. I want to do my part to help the planet, although I am unwilling to give up most of the creature comforts that we all take for granted.

Organic cosmetics are getting more and more coverage these days, but is what you read fact or fiction? A product labeled "organic" is not necessarily free from harmful ingredients. There are many unknowns and misconceptions in the world of organic cosmetics, it is worthwhile to know how to spot the real thing.

A good example is deodorant. Most women use widely available major brands typically seen on the shelves of grocers and drugstores. What they don't know is many of these deodorants contain aluminum chlorhydrate which is a known skin irritant. Organic mineral based deodorants and other personal care products are available along with quality organic cosmetics online.
